Transaction 40642b558ff0fb833c912473add4428618733f0a8b0c3a807528494542420082
1 Input
1 Output
-
40642b558ff0fb833c912473add4428618733f0a8b0c3a807528494542420082:0
- value
- 73513
- script pubkey
- OP_0 OP_PUSHBYTES_20 35a3ec0e7cda9b543da17836b30f6514dd3b9d83
- address
- bc1qxk37crnum2d4g0dp0qmtxrm9znwnh8vrwf5l84